ROYAL WELCOME.

ENTHUSIASM IN UNITED STATES,

TRIBUTE BY DUKE OF KENT.

(United Press Association—Copyright (Received This Day, 9.20 a.m.) LONDON, July 4.

Tlie Duke of Kent, speaking at the American Society’s Independence Day dinner, paid a tribute to the enthusiasm of their Majesties 2 ' reception in the United States. He added that such spontaneous expressions 'of ’friendship' were most encouraging' irt these tr'ou blous times‘and proved that the' ideal'of peace was undoubtedly achievable."
